It'll have about 170-180hp as it stands Miltek doesn't really help tbh.
You'd need a hybrid and a map, a FMIC won't help much either tbh. Hybrids can be picked up for around £400 and a further £400 for a good map. Not really worth doing for an extra 20-30hp IMO.

It is not Stage 2 it is Stage 1 (if it can be called that!) - What you talk of would be heading for a Stage 2....
Upping the turbo size means upping fuelling and cooling.... ie, bigger injectors, FMIC and a new map to accomodate...
